Mrs Broomfield June 2026
We had a wonderful stay at Mowhay Barn. It was such a peaceful setting, garden & interior that we felt very relaxed and calm, a lovely and stress free holiday. As a party of 5 adults the barn had enough living space that we could all get together in the living rooms but also find a quiet space when we wanted. It would easily take a larger family group or couples sharing. The kitchen was perfect for getting together and was well equipped to make home cooked meals so we had the choice to eat in when we wanted with large tables there & in the dining room. The bedroom layout worked very well. The en suite king size room being downstairs meant we all had space & privacy and upstairs gave everyone space and fantastic views. The extra shower room downstairs was very useful. We spent a lot of time in the garden watching the birds & enjoying the views & fantastic sunsets towards Sennen. You can drive (or walk if you’re fit) to the coast and to several local coves and beaches and also enjoy the surfing nearby in Sennen & can easily reach St Ives and Hayle. Lots to do for all generations - St Just and Penzance are easy to reach by car for all we needed and for some nice food, shops & culture & there’s the walks, wildlife and fascinating history of the area too. Too much to write here but there’s a thoughtful list of suggestions provided by the lovely owners, who were kind enough to accommodate an extra car space for us and kindly helped with a couple of extra requests. We had lovely weather but although it can be changeable in Penwith there’s enough to do with lots of books & games. A cosy day or more in the Barn would be great if it’s wet. We won’t hestitate to return when we can next get together - it was well worth the drive to nearly Lands End! Thanks to the owners for the opportunity to stay in such a lovely place. ...
